The Most Expensive Mistake Business Leaders Make | Chasing Away Top Performers By Tolerating Bad Ones
What message is being sent to a team when poor performance goes unaddressed?
What you'll learn in this episode:
In this week’s episode, Rich and Jason tackle one of the most costly leadership mistakes in business: allowing poor performance to persist at the expense of their top talent. They explain how tolerated behavior lowers organizational standards, and why avoiding accountability can drive away high-achieving talent that sustains the company. Jason and Rich share actionable advice and frameworks leaders can use to identify performance issues, protect and strengthen culture, and build a system where high performers thrive.
